As the Foundation Acting Course Leader at ArtsEd I Direct half the cohort In their Acting Play Project. This is a culmination of the course which is presented in the Studio Theatre at the Lyric Hammersmith Theatre to students, staff, invited industry guests and friends and family.


2023 | RAGE by Simon Stephens

2024 | The Suicide - A comedy by Suhayla El-Bushra after Erdman

2025 | GREENLAND by Moira Buffini, Penelope Skinner, Matt Charman and Jack Thorne

The Last March

Old Salt Theatre

Dog sleds, icy adventure, and a bitter race to the end; The Last March is the thrilling comedy of Captain Scott’s last daring bid to conquer the South Pole is brought to life onstage. Using spirited humour, frantic physicality and of course bucket loads of revitalising tea.

Floor Plan by Openbatch Theatre

The audience witness the space transform into a factory when a floor plan is laid with electrical tape. The factory is bought to life. The action is punctuated by a series of narratives that focus on moments of humanity in an oppressive environment.•
